Whether considering effective management of vehicles while on fleet, or what to be aware of at the end of the vehicle cycle, the dedicated workstreams of Vehicle and Fleet Management (VFM) and Residual Value and Remarketing (RVR) Forums keep members fully informed.

The focal point of the Forums is to bring subject matter experts together to discuss the key issues, trends and opportunities.

Chaired by Karl Lord of Enterprise, the RVR programme provides valuable insight into the used market including business critical data on electric vehicles. Common topics also include the instability in the van market and looks ahead on what to expect from emerging OEMs. The next Forum takes place on Thursday 19 June at GWM ORA in Solihull.

The VFM programme is chaired by Blaine Colston of Kinto UK and reflects the changing nature of vehicle service, maintenance and repair. It does this by looking at use of data for preventative maintenance, artificial intelligence, and the preparedness of the sector for electric vehicles and new manufacturers entering the market.
